Colonial Style Wallpapers & Wall Murals

Colonial style wallpapers draw on the aesthetic of historic American estates and Georgian-era interiors, bringing a sense of quiet refinement and heritage character to a room. Typical design directions include classic botanical prints, architectural motifs, and structured patterns that feel considered rather than decorative for decoration's sake. The overall effect is formal without being stiff, with a warmth that suits homes where traditional details are already part of the picture.

Rooms where the colonial aesthetic tends to feel at home

These wallpapers and wall murals work particularly well in formal dining rooms, libraries, home studies, and guest bedrooms. They suit spaces where you want a composed, settled atmosphere rather than something graphic or contemporary. A single feature wall can be enough to anchor a room, especially when paired with a fireplace, original cornicing, or period joinery. Applying colonial style wallpaper across all four walls creates a more immersive, enveloping feel that works well in rooms with strong architectural detail and good natural light.

Dark woods, brass, and muted tones

In terms of colour, colonial style mural wallpapers tend to sit comfortably alongside muted, natural tones: sage green, soft cream, warm white, and deep navy all complement the heritage character of the aesthetic well. Dark wood furniture in mahogany, walnut, or cherry is a natural pairing, as are traditional materials such as brass, linen, and woven textiles. For a room that already leans traditional, these wallpapers can help period features like crown moulding or timber panelling feel intentional rather than incidental.

The style also translates well into transitional interiors, where classic furniture and more contemporary pieces sit alongside each other without conflict. In that context, keeping the surrounding palette restrained lets the wallpaper carry the heritage character without the room feeling heavily themed.

Choosing between a feature wall and a fuller treatment

One of the more useful decisions when working with colonial style wallpaper is how much of the room to cover. A single wall behind a bed or a dining table can introduce the aesthetic as a focal point while keeping the rest of the room lighter and more flexible. This approach works especially well with bolder pattern choices, where a full room might feel heavy. Covering all four walls, on the other hand, creates that rich, library-like atmosphere that suits the colonial style at its most considered, particularly in rooms with high ceilings or good proportions.

If you are unsure how a design will read in your space, ordering a sample before committing to a full wall is a sensible step, as the character of heritage patterns can shift quite noticeably depending on the room's light and scale.
